Comprehending Door Lock Components
Door locks are intricate devices made up of several essential elements. Below is a table detailing these parts and their functions:
ComponentDescriptionCylinderThe part where the key is placed, consisting of pins that line up with the secret's cuts.SecretA piece of metal developed to fit a specific lock cylinder and operate it.LatchThe mechanism that holds the door closed and can be released by turning the handle or key.Strike PlateThe metal plate connected to the door frame that the latch protects versus.DeadboltA locking mechanism that provides additional security and extends into the [sliding door locks](https://replacementdoorlocks41963.laowaiblog.com/38222868/ten-best-locks-for-doors-replacements-that-really-help-you-live-better) frame.Thumb TurnA lever that enables locking and unlocking the deadbolt from the inside without a key.FaceplateThe cover that protects the internal parts and contributes to the lock's looks.ScrewsFasteners that hold the lock assembly and other elements in location.Signs Your Door Lock Needs Replacement
Door locks do not last forever, and several signs can indicate it's time for a replacement. A few of these consist of:
Difficulty Turning the Key: If the key feels stiff or gets stuck often, the internal elements might be broken.Rust or Corrosion: Visible rust or staining can badly impact the functionality of the lock.Physical Damage: Any indications of breakage, such as cracks or damages, can deteriorate the lock and compromise security.Inconsistent Locking: If the lock stops working to engage or disengage regularly, it can lead to unsafe conditions.Missing Keys: If keys are lost, it may be more secure to change the whole lock rather than run the risk of unauthorized access.Sound: If the lock makes unusual noises when being utilized, it could show internal damage.Types of Door Lock Parts Replacements1. Step-by-Step Guide to Door Lock Parts Replacement
Replacing door lock parts requires particular tools and following a methodical method. Here's a detailed guide.
Tools You'll Need:Screwdriver (flat-head and Phillips)Replacement parts (cylinder, latch, and so on)Lubricant (silicone-based)Measuring tapeHammer (if required)Steps to Replace a Door Lock:
Assess the Lock: Determine which element needs replacement.

Collect Your Tools: Assemble all required tools and replacement parts.

Remove the Lock Assembly:
Begin by loosening the faceplate and any other visible screws.Thoroughly pull the lock apart, beginning from the exterior side of the door.
Change the Cylinder or Latch:
If you are changing the cylinder, get rid of the old cylinder by pulling it out of its housing.Insert the new cylinder and secure it with screws.If the latch is being replaced, guarantee the new latch aligns with the existing holes.
Install the New Lock:
Align the new components and reattach the faceplate.Ensure everything is tight and secure by tightening up screws.
Check the Lock:
Insert the key or turn the thumb turn to check the lock's functionality. Guarantee it locks and opens smoothly without resistance.
Lube: Apply a little amount of lube to minimize friction and to assist maintain the lock's condition.

Recheck Alignment: After installation, make certain the strike plate lines up properly with the doorframe.
